Job Description

The IT Specialist will be responsible for overseeing, supporting, and maintaining the IT infrastructure across the United States to ensure secure, stable, and efficient operations. In this role, you will lead the execution of IT infrastructure projects for new sites, ensuring delivery within scope, timeline, and budget, while managing vendor relationships and contributing to the region’s digital transformation. This position requires deep technical expertise in IT infrastructure, strong project management capabilities, and the 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ams and external partners.

RESPONSIBILITIES

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ead IT infrastructure projects for new sites across the United States, ensuring delivery on scope, timeline, and budget.
  • Support the opening, relocation, and transformation of offices and boutiques from planning through deployment, aligning with business objectives.
  • Coordinate effectively with internal departments, external partners, and IT team members to ensure seamless project execution.
  • Estimate workloads, manage project timelines and milestones, control budgets, and propose implementation plans.
  • Represent the IT Infrastructure team in cross-functional and interdisciplinary initiatives.
  • Contribute to the design and evolution of IT infrastructure concepts to meet operational and strategic needs.
  • Oversee the maintenance of IT systems, including server rooms, telephony, and infrastructure components.
  • Provide technical support during corporate events and special initiatives.
  • Assist with onboarding and training new hires to ensure smooth integration into IT systems and processes.
